import re
import sys
from StringIO import StringIO
from nose.tools import assert_equals, assert_not_equals
from lettuce import registry
from difflib import Differ
def prepare_stdout():
registry.clear()
if isinstance(sys.stdout, StringIO):
del sys.stdout
std = StringIO()
sys.stdout = std
def prepare_stderr():
registry.clear()
if isinstance(sys.stderr, StringIO):
del sys.stderr
std = StringIO()
sys.stderr = std
def assert_lines(original, expected):
original = original.decode('utf-8') if isinstance(original, basestring) else original
assert_lines_unicode(original, expected)
def assert_lines_unicode(original, expected):
if original != expected:
diff = ''.join(list(Differ().compare(expected.splitlines(1), original.splitlines(1))))
raise AssertionError, 'Output differed as follows:\n' + diff + "\nOutput was:\n" + original +"\nExpected was:\n"+expected
assert_equals(len(expected), len(original), 'Output appears equal, but of different lengths.')
def assert_lines_with_traceback(one, other):
lines_one = one.splitlines()
lines_other = other.splitlines()
regex = re.compile('File "([^"]+)", line \d+, in.*')
error = '%r should be in traceback line %r.\nFull output was:\n' + one
for line1, line2 in zip(lines_one, lines_other):
if regex.search(line1) and regex.search(line2):
found = regex.search(line2)
filename = found.group(1)
params = filename, line1
assert filename in line1, error % params
else:
assert_unicode_equals(line1, line2)
assert_unicode_equals(len(lines_one), len(lines_other))
def assert_unicode_equals(original, expected):
if isinstance(original, basestring):
original = original.decode('utf-8')
assert_equals(original, expected)
def assert_stderr(expected):
string = sys.stderr.getvalue()
assert_unicode_equals(string, expected)
def assert_stdout(expected):
string = sys.stdout.getvalue()
assert_unicode_equals(string, expected)
def assert_stdout_lines(other):
assert_lines(sys.stdout.getvalue(), other)
def assert_stderr_lines(other):
assert_lines(sys.stderr.getvalue(), other)
def assert_stdout_lines_with_traceback(other):
assert_lines_with_traceback(sys.stdout.getvalue(), other)
def assert_stderr_lines_with_traceback(other):
assert_lines_with_traceback(sys.stderr.getvalue(), other)
